1The terms "motherhood" and "mother" can run the risk of reproducing social attributions and stereotypes. We explicitly advocate for a use of these terms that reflects these attributions and is open to the diversity of mothers and motherhood. Not only cisgender women are mothers, not all mothers have given birth, and not all who have given birth are mothers.
Furthermore, motherhood does not only concern mothers – all people perceived as female will be confronted with the topic in different ways at some point in their lives – regardless of whether they actually have children, want to or can have children. By "mother"/"mothers," we mean, on the one hand, people who identify as mothers, regardless of their gender, and, on the other hand, people who experience or are confronted with motherhood, even if they do not identify as mothers.
